En este caso, teniendo en mente la definición de ley de velocidad, es posible recordar que esta tiene la forma genérica:
En donde k es la constante de velocidad, [A] la concentration de cualquier especie A en la reacción y m el orden the reacción. Ahora, hay tres órdenes de reacción, cero, primer, y segundo orden, y esto pasa cuando m=0, m=1 y m=2 respectivamente. Por lo tanto, si la reacción es de orden cero, la rapidez de reacción resulta igual a la constante de velocidad dado que la concentración estaría elevada a la cero y por consiguiente siempre tendrá valor de 1, por lo que la concentración no afecta la velocidad de reacción. An emulsion is a suspension of two liquids that actually do not mix together.these liquids that do not mix are said to be immiscible .an example :-
would be oil and water.lf you mix oil and water and shake them a cloudy suspension is formed

5. An exothermic reaction is a reaction in which heat is given off.
An endothermic reaction is a reaction in which heat is absorbed in the process.
An exothermic reaction is always warmer after the reaction whereas an endothermic reaction is colder at the end of the reaction.
